2016-09-30 27 views
8

Korzystam z Ulepszonego e-commerce, aby monitorować zdarzenia związane z procesem realizacji transakcji krok po kroku.Dane, które nie pojawiają się w Zakupach Zakupowych

Uwaga: Triple potwierdził, że WE jest włączona w usłudze Analytics i Etykiety Zamówienie ścieżek zostały ustawione (choć te ostatnie nie jest wymagane w każdym razie)

Gdy użytkownik kliknie przycisk „Następny krok” na etapie 1 poniższy kod zostanie zwolniony:

ga('ec:setAction', 'checkout', {step: 1}); 
ga(
    'send', 
    'event', 
    'Checkout', 
    'Customer Proceeding to Select Accomodation' 
) 

zdarzenie pojawi się w Real-Time > Events:

How it appears in GA

..ale nie pojawi się Conversions > Ecommerce > Shopping Analysis > Checkout Behavior

nie mogę znaleźć gdzie idę źle uratować moje życie tutaj, więc wszelkie wskazówki byłyby bardzo mile widziane

+0

Jak długo czekać? – DaImTo

+0

W połowie rozwoju ogromnego systemu i zacząłem wysyłanie zdarzeń przez około 3 tygodnie temu i rozproszyłem się z innym szczegółem. Teraz jestem z powrotem na tym i nadal nic. Więc 3 tygodnie 1 dzień. – zanderwar

+0

Otworzyłem nagrodę, wciąż nie otrzymuję niczego w analizie zakupów, mimo że zdarzenia są wysyłane setki razy dziennie w kategorii "kasy" i pojawiają się w wydarzeniach – zanderwar

Odpowiedz

2

Pierwszy problem widzę jest ga (” ec: setAction ',' checkout ', {' step ': 1}); (Krok wprowadzający w cudzysłowie)

Problem może nadal występować, a to jest ogólna lista kontrolna do zastosowania analizy zakupów.

  • W kodzie śledzenia Google Analytics należy uwzględnić rozszerzoną wtyczkę e-commerce. ga ("require", "ec");

  • Aby zapewnić przepływ danych do raportu Zachowanie zakupów, należy wysłać wszystkie kroki ec: setAction. Ważne jest, aby wysłać te wydarzenia i we właściwej kolejności, zasugerowałem także, kiedy powinieneś to zrobić w komentarzach, ale to do ciebie.

ga(‘ec:setAction’, ‘detail’); 
 
//Set this parameter when a visitor views a Product Detail page. 
 

 
ga(‘ec:setAction’, ‘add’); 
 
//Set this parameter when a visitor adds a product to their cart. 
 

 
ga(‘ec:setAction’, ‘checkout’); 
 
//Set this parameter when a visitor views the checkout process pages. 
 

 
ga(‘ec:setAction’, ‘purchase’); 
 
//Set this parameter when a visitor views an Order Confirmation page.

  • Realizując etapy analizy zakupów, jak wspomniano powyżej, należy sprawdzić wszystkie wymagane parametry są ustawione.

  • etapy (co odpowiada do kroku numer dla kasie) powinien określony w sekcji administracyjnej Google Analytics (który myślę, że już zrobił)